1. Cozy Modern Farmhouse Kitchen

pink and green kitchen ideas 1

Imagine stepping into a cozy kitchen where a pastel pink island takes center stage, framed by mint green cabinetry. The combination of soft hues creates an inviting atmosphere, enhanced by the natural light pouring in from large windows.

White marble countertops add a touch of elegance, while decorative elements like potted herbs on the windowsill and vintage dishware on open shelves lend a charming rustic feel. The mix of textures, from the smooth surfaces of the island to the warmth of wooden accents, brings a sense of comfort and homeliness to the space.

In this kitchen, the thoughtful arrangement of colors and materials fosters a cheerful ambiance that encourages culinary creativity and family gatherings. The combination of pink and green is not only aesthetically pleasing but also promotes a feeling of relaxation, making it a perfect environment for cooking and sharing meals.

  • Use pastel shades for cabinetry and islands to create a soft, inviting look.
  • Incorporate natural elements like herbs to enhance the kitchen’s fresh vibe.
  • Choose vintage dishware for open shelves to add character.
  • Opt for white marble countertops to contrast beautifully with the soft colors.

5. Luxurious Art Deco Kitchen

pink and green kitchen ideas 5

This luxurious kitchen showcases an art deco style, featuring emerald green cabinets adorned with gold trim and blush pink marble countertops. Statement lighting fixtures add drama and elegance, while decorative elements like a vintage clock and geometric patterns enhance the sophistication of the space.

The overall mood is glamorous, inviting culinary exploration and entertaining.

The combination of rich colors and luxurious materials creates a stunning visual impact, making this kitchen a feast for the eyes. It is a space that inspires creativity while providing a stylish backdrop for social gatherings, where every meal feels like a celebration.

  • Incorporate gold accents for a touch of luxury.
  • Choose bold colors and patterns to create visual interest.
  • Use statement lighting to enhance the design.
  • Opt for marble countertops for an elegant finish.

9. Playful Retro 50s Kitchen

pink and green kitchen ideas 9

This playful kitchen design embraces a retro 50s flair, featuring checkerboard flooring in pink and green, along with a vintage-style stove and refrigerator. Bright artwork adorns the walls, evoking a sense of nostalgia and fun.

A cozy breakfast nook adds charm and encourages family gatherings, making every meal feel special.

The vibrant colors and playful design elements create an atmosphere that is lively and inviting, perfect for family breakfasts and casual dining experiences. This kitchen captures the essence of a bygone era, where every detail contributes to a warm and welcoming environment.

  • Use checkerboard flooring for a nostalgic retro feel.
  • Incorporate vintage appliances for authenticity.
  • Add colorful artwork for visual appeal.
  • Design a cozy nook to encourage family bonding.
